No, they haven't won. You can't even see 0.1% of the spambots that post here.
From the looks of that screenshot, all you're seeing is ONE overzealous spambot that made it through the filter. This is not a phenomenon; it happens... regularly.
It is business as usual for the mods. We will continue to clean thousands and thousands of unseen posts (manually) while some posters feel the need to comment about the random few that they can see.
What i'm getting at here, is that it's no big deal. So STOP acknowledging them. STOP quoting them. STOP talking to them. STOP making not-so-funny-after-the-millionth-time jokes about their posts.
It makes more work for us mods because it:
- Messes with the filter
- Adds to their spam & derailment
- Encourages those who sent them
So then I have to not only delete and ban the bot, but also infract/warn and remove/edit the subsequent spambot-related posts.
Want to help out? Easy peezy lemon squeezy! It's simple. Ignore the spambot. Then report the spambot's post. Then continue to post as if it doesn't exist. Done!
